Aviation Expert! Take to the skies with the Pilot emoji, a symbol of aviation and travel.
An individual wearing a pilot’s uniform, often depicted with a hat and wings badge. The Pilot emoji is commonly used to represent flying, aviation, and travel. It can also be used to discuss airline industry topics or to highlight a love for flying. If someone sends you a 🧑✈️ emoji, it could mean they are talking about travel, discussing flights, or are interested in aviation.
The 🧑✈️ Pilot emoji represents a person who operates an aircraft, typically as their profession or occupation.
